gpt4 book ai didi

reactjs - 从 jsx 文件导入 sass 变量

转载 作者:行者123 更新时间:2023-12-04 16:00:03 25 4
gpt4 key购买 nike

我正在开发一个使用 create-react-app 构建的 React 项目。我有一个名为 common.scss 的文件,我在其中保存了一个变量列表,例如:

$blue: 'blue';
$red: 'red';

SCSS 文件使用 node-sass-chokidar 进行了预处理。

我希望能够将这些变量导入到我的 jsx 文件中,但我找不到不弹出的明确方法。你能告诉我一种无需弹出即可执行此操作的方法吗?

谢谢。

最佳答案

如果您使用 CSS modules ,您可以导入一个导出了一些变量的 css 文件。

$blue: 'blue';
$red: 'red';

:export {
blue: $blue;
red: $red;
}

然后将它们作为js使用。

import css from 'path/to/your/file.scss'
/*
...
*/
<div style={{color: css.blue}} />

关于reactjs - 从 jsx 文件导入 sass 变量,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/50784362/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com